Gambling in Atlantic City

Wagering in Atlantic City, first made legal in 1978, has given an awesome boost to the economy. As a result of this, Atlantic City is now a dominant tourist industry, with millions of visitors each year, paying billions of dollars for entertainment.

When you think of gambling in Atlantic City, you will most likely to think ‘Poker’. In excess of fifty million people compete in poker at a minimum once a month and Atlantic City offers some of the greatest casino poker rooms in the country.Just about all of these are placed by the Boardwalk and in the Marina area. Bally’s, Harrah’s, and the Sands are fairly small when compared to a few of the other casinos, although they offer many low-limit poker tables and daily tournaments in Texas Holdem, seven-Card Stud, and Omaha/8 poker.

The poker rooms at the Sands, Bally’s Wild Wild West, and most of the other casinos have a large number of non-smoking tables for players. The Tropicana has sporting events on TV that can be seen from any and all table. The Tropicana also offers the Trop Poker Club, open 24 hours, 7 days a week, in which its members can acquire anywhere from fifty cents to $2.00 an hour for every real life poker game they participate in. This Trop money can be used for room, snacks, or drink credit and are just another enticement to participate in poker.

Playing in Atlantic City is often closely identified with the very popular Trump Taj Majal, which announced the very first non-smoking poker room. There are more than 70 tables, where you are able to compete in quite a few types of poker, including 5-Card Stud, Texas Holdem, and Omaha Hold’em, for a tiny entry of one dollar all the way up to six hundred dollars. Daily tournaments, hi/lo poker games, and two yearly tournaments, which are the U.S. Poker Championship and the Trump Classic. The Taj Majal, as well as numerous other casinos, offer free poker lessons for the newbie.
